NEW CHOIR DIRECTOR
Along with our new archbishop, we now have a new choir director, replacing Pat Buchanan, who moved
out of the parish. He is Chris Belcher, and has already been serving with our music ministries for many years,
at both the 5:00PM Saturday Mass and the 9:30 Sunday Mass. We are very pleased that he has accepted this
role, for not only does he provide needed continuity, but he’s a very fine musician, to boot! God bless him
and all our singers and musicians!

QUIZ-A-CATHOLIC
With the installation of our new archbishop, Abp. Mitchell Rozanski, I decided to make this quiz on
the bishops and archbishops of St. Louis, past and present. See how much you know:
1. Where is Abp. Rozanski from?
2. How old is Abp. Rozanski?
3. How many of our bishops/archbishops were foreign-born?
4. Who was our longest-serving bishop?
5. Who was our shortest-serving bishop?
6. How many of our bishops served here as cardinals?
7. Did any of our bishops become cardinals after they left St. Louis?
8. Are any of our former archbishops still alive?
9. Did we ever have a bishop who wasn’t an archbishop?
10. Name all eleven bishops/archbishops of St. Louis, where they’re from and where they’re buried.
ANSWERS: 1. Baltimore, by way of Springfield, MA 2. He just turned 62 (Aug. 6) 3. Three: Kenrick and Glennon (Ireland), and Rosati (Italy) 4. Kenrick (51.5 years) 5. Burke (4.5 years) 6. Three: Glennon, Ritter, and Carberry 7. Yes, Rigali and Burke 8. Yes, Rigali, Burke, and Carlson 9. Yes, our first bishop,

Joseph Rosati 10. Joseph Rosati (1827-43) Italy/Old Cathedral, Peter R. Kenrick (1843-95) Ireland/Calvary Cemetery, John J. Kain (1895-1903) W. Virginia/Calvary Cemetery, John J. Glen-non (1903-46) Ireland/Cathedral Basilica (C.B.), Joseph Cardinal Ritter (1946-67) Indiana/C.B., John Cardinal Carberry (1968-79) Brooklyn/C.B., John L. May (1980-92) Chicago/C.B., Justin Cardinal Rigali (1994-2003) Los Angeles/still living, Raymond Cardinal Burke (2003-08) LaCrosse, WI/still living, Robert J. Carlson, (2009-2020) St. Paul, MN/still living, Mitchell T. Rozan-ski (2020-) Baltimore/still serving
